What Makes Up an Actor's Net Worth?
When we talk about an actor's net worth, it's not just a simple calculation of their salary. There are, actually, quite a few different things that can add up to that final estimated number. Think about it: an actor's income can come from many places, and some of those streams are more consistent than others. It's a bit like a puzzle, in a way, with different pieces contributing to the whole picture.
First off, the most obvious source of income for an actor is their salary from acting roles. This includes their pay for appearing in TV shows, movies, or even stage productions. For someone like Courtney Hope, who has had long-running roles on soap operas, that steady paycheck from being on a show for years can be a really significant part of their overall earnings. It's a pretty reliable source, you could say, compared to one-off movie roles.
Then there are residuals and royalties. These are payments actors receive when their work is re-aired or streamed after the initial broadcast. So, if an old episode of a show Courtney Hope was in gets replayed, she might get a small payment for that. These can add up over time, especially for popular shows that are rerun often. It's like getting paid again for work you've already done, which is pretty neat.
Beyond acting itself, many public figures also earn money from endorsements. This could mean promoting products on social media, appearing in commercials for a brand, or even being the face of a company. These deals can be quite lucrative, depending on the actor's popularity and reach. It's a way for them to leverage their public profile, you know, to bring in extra cash.
Other income sources might include personal appearances, speaking engagements, or even starting their own businesses or product lines. Some actors, for instance, might write books, launch clothing brands, or invest in real estate. These ventures can sometimes bring in a lot of money, perhaps even more than their acting work, depending on how successful they are. It's a bit of a gamble sometimes, but it can pay off.
Finally, there's the question of investments. Like anyone else, actors might invest their earnings in stocks, bonds, or property. The growth of these investments over time can significantly contribute to their overall net worth. It's a smart way, basically, to make your money work for you, which is something anyone with a steady income might consider.

Do soap opera actors earn a lot of money?
Yes, many soap opera actors, especially those who have been on long-running shows for many years and have prominent roles, can earn a very good living. Their salaries can range from tens of thousands to hundreds of thousands of dollars annually, or even more for the most established stars. The consistent work and loyal viewership of daytime dramas mean steady paychecks, which is a pretty big deal in the often unpredictable acting world.
